Interesting response. I wasn't being sarcastic or snippy.
I was actually relaying my own experience. I thought I'd save $ going to the hardware store myself. After buying all the necessary pieces, I ended up spending just as much (and some times more). And worse... wasted a bunch of time doing it, especially when selection is almost never diverse enough.
I found it's just easier and more reliable to buy them from the person who has specifically chosen them to match; unless of course they are outrageously overpriced. (Which the Kartboy ones are not)
